Apple Coconut Bread

By: Im A StAr  
"A fresh tasting quick bread with apples, coconut and cranberries. Perfect for a chilly fall day. It can also be made vegan if you use a vegan margarine in place of the butter."

Original Recipe Yield 12 servings
 

Ingredients

  • 3 cups all-purpose flour
  • 4 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on ground nutmeg
  • 1 1/2 tablespoons ground cinnamon
  • 3/4 cup soy milk
  • 1 tablespoon v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up butter or margarine, melted
  • 3 apples, cored and chopped
  • 1/2 cup sweetened dried cranberries (optional)
  • 1 cup flaked coconut

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ease a 9x5 inch loaf pan.
  2. In a large bowl, stir together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, nutmeg and cinnamon. Make a well in the center, and pour in the soy milk, vanilla and melted butter. Stir just until dry ingredients are moistened. Mix in the apples, dried cranberries and most of the coconut. Reserve a small handful for sprinkling over the top of the loaf. Pour into the prepared loaf pan, and sprinkle reserved coconut on top.
  3. Bake for 40 to 45 minutes in the preheated oven, until a knife inserted into the loaf comes out clean. Cool for at least 5 minutes before removing from the pan.
